After coming to Diablo 4, DOOM: The Dark Ages is headed to Diablo Immortal
The collaboration between id Software’s DOOM: The Dark Ages and Diablo is set to continue as Blizzard has announced a new limited-time Slayer’s Reign crossover event set to kick off on April 17 in Diablo Immortal. Immortal is Blizzard’s successful mobile take on the franchise, which, like the mainline Diablo 4, continues to receive updates and new content.

Diablo 4 recently saw the arrival of its own DOOM: The Dark Ages crossover event in its latest season, offering players the chance to unlock Slayer-themed gear and cosmetics, including a new premium mount modeled after the giant mecha-dragon creatures you can ride in the latest DOOM.
As for DOOM: The Dark Ages and Diablo Immortal coming together, well, expect more hell meets hell goodies, including new gameplay, enemies, cosmetics, and even progression systems. Here’s the breakdown of what’s coming.
- Slayer’s Bane - A reimagining of Diablo Immortal’s Survivors Bane mode with DOOM’s signature aggression and momentum. Players wield Slayer‑inspired abilities and iconic weapons, including the Shield Saw, Dreadmace, and Super Shotgun, designed to reward relentless offense and crowd control.
- DOOM enemies storm Sanctuary - Imps roam the battlefield, and the towering Cyberdemon serves as the event’s ultimate boss encounter—reimagined within Diablo Immortal’s dark fantasy world.
- The Crucible, Legendary Gem - A new Legendary Gem inspired by DOOM lore. The gem enables devastating finishing effects and stacking damage bonuses, capturing the fantasy of the Slayer’s unstoppable fury inside Diablo Immortal’s progression systems.
- Cosmetics and collectibles - Earn DOOM-inspired weapon skins forged with Argent Energy, the Slayer’s iconic Praetor Armor, and new Familiars, including the Cacodemon and Serrat mount.
